多语言展示
当前在线:1441今日阅读:86今日分享:14

用MATLAB实现仿真图像

数学建模大家都不陌生,但是你建好模型了要这么仿真呢?所以我这里来介绍一下MATLAB的仿真应用(MATLAB2010的)。
工具/原料
1

安装好了的MATLAB

2

一定的数学知识

3

电脑

方法/步骤
1

打开安装好了的MATLAB(我这里是2010b,就不特别说明了),你会见如下图所示:clc(清屏)清屏后如下图:

2

接下来我们就可以仿真了,在之前你要学习MATLAB的一些基础知识,那现在我就来写 仿真代码:[x,y]=meshgrid(0:0.25:4*pi);z=sin(x+sin(y))-x/10;mesh(x,y,z);axis([0 4*pi 0 4*pi -2.5 1]);写好代码运行后如下图所示

3

解释以上代码:[x,y]=meshgrid(0:0.25:4*pi);利用meshgrid函数产生平面区域内的网格坐标矩阵。z=sin(x+sin(y))-x/10;这是我们 所仿真的函数。mesh(x,y,z);输出仿真函数。axis([0 4*pi 0 4*pi -2.5 1]);控制仿真图像所在的区域;

4

就这样可以小部分仿真了,这是我写的z=exp(x+sin(y))-x/10的仿真图像

5

还可以多图仿真

6

我这里就写完,如果有什么问题大家可以讨论。

注意事项
1

代码不 要写错

2

中英文输入问题

推荐信息